Meanings

Noununloader

A person whose job is to remove goods or cargo from a vehicle, ship, or aircraft.

The warehouse hired an extra unloader to help with the shipment.

Noununloader

A mechanical device or piece of machinery used to remove materials from a container or transport vehicle.

The industrial unloader quickly emptied the grain truck into the silo.

Noununloader

A device in a mechanical system, such as a hydraulic circuit, that reduces or removes the load from a component to prevent damage or allow movement.

The system includes an automatic unloader to protect the pump from overpressure.
